3. Anticipate changes Add at least one new member per month Plan for future Have a minimum of 20 members at year-end Membership Goals
4. Promote benefits to current members Promote Toastmasters benefits to others Hold at least two membership contests Offer recognition Strategies for Membership Growth

6. Personally welcome guests and introduce them to others Explain benefits Vote Complete application / submit online Welcome new members into the club Transform Guests into Members

9. Contact absent members Conduct surveys Distribute evaluation forms Guarantee Member Satisfaction
10. Attend club executive committee meetings Attend and vote at area council meetings Attend district-sponsored club officers training Arrange for a replacement if unable to attend a club meeting Prepare your successor for office Standards Outside the Club Meeting
11. Greet guests and have each complete a guest card Work with President and VP – Education in formally inducting new members Standards at the Club Meeting
